Search Header Logo

PYTHON - Câu lệnh lặp

Authored by Kim Ngọc Huỳnh

Professional Development

2nd Grade

Used 38+ times

PYTHON - Câu lệnh lặp
AI

AI Actions

Add similar questions

Adjust reading levels

Convert to real-world scenario

Translate activity

More...

    Content View

    Student View

10 questions

Show all answers

1.

MULTIPLE CHOICE QUESTION

10 mins • 1 pt

Phát biểu đúng về Vòng lặp (loop) là :

Vòng lặp là thuật ngữ để chỉ một hành động hoặc cụm hành động được lặp đi lặp lại nhiều lần.

Vòng lặp giúp bạn tiết kiệm thời gian, lập trình nhanh và hiệu quả hơn.

Có 2 loại vòng lặp chính trong Python đó là: vòng lặp for và vòng lặp while

Cả 3 đáp án đều đúng

2.

MULTIPLE CHOICE QUESTION

10 mins • 1 pt

Chọn câu trả lời chính xác nhất trong các câu sau:

Vòng lặp for trong python được sử dụng để lặp một biến dữ liệu qua một dạy theo thứ tự mà chúng xuất hiện, nếu số lần lặp cố định hay nói cách khác lặp với số lần đã biết trước thì sử dụng vòng lặp for.

Vòng lặp while trong python được dùng để lặp lại một khối lệnh khi điều kiện kiểm tra là đúng.Thường sử dụng vòng lặp này khi không biết trước số lần lặp là bao nhiêu.

Lặp với số lần chưa xác định trước ta sử dụng vòng lặp for, còn lặp với số lần đã xác định trước ta sử dụng vòng lặp while

Cả 2 đáp áp đều đúng là:

- Vòng lặp for trong python được sử dụng để lặp một biến dữ liệu qua một dạy theo thứ tự mà chúng xuất hiện, nếu số lần lặp cố định hay nói cách khác lặp với số lần đã biết trước thì sử dụng vòng lặp for.

- Vòng lặp while trong python được dùng để lặp lại một khối lệnh khi điều kiện kiểm tra là đúng.Thường sử dụng vòng lặp này khi không biết trước số lần lặp là bao nhiêu.

3.

MULTIPLE CHOICE QUESTION

10 mins • 1 pt

 Cho đoạn chương trình Python sau:

so = 2

while so < 10:

print(so)

so = so +2

Kết quả của chương trình là:

2,4,6,8,10

2,3,4,5,6,7,8,9,10

2,3,4,5,6,7,8,9

2,4,6,8

4.

MULTIPLE CHOICE QUESTION

10 mins • 1 pt

Phát biểu đúng về Hàm Range() trong vòng vòng lặp for là :

Hàm Range() có thể được sử dụng để tạo ra một dãy số

Cấu trúc hàm: Range(giá trị bắt đầu, giá trị kết thúc, khoảng cách giữa hai giá trị)

Hàm không lưu tất cả các giá trị trong bộ nhớ. Nó chỉ lưu giá trị bắt đầu, giá trị kết thúc và khoảng cách giữa hai số, từ đó tạo ra số tiếp theo trong dãy

Tất cả đáp án đều đúng.

5.

MULTIPLE CHOICE QUESTION

10 mins • 1 pt

Cho đoạn chương trình Python sau:

for i in range(1,10,3);

print(i)

Kết quả của chương trình là:

1,3,5,7,9

1,4,7

1,10,3

1,2,3,4,5,,6,7,8,9,10

6.

MULTIPLE CHOICE QUESTION

10 mins • 1 pt

Cho đoạn chương trình Python sau:

musics = [“ballad”, “rock”, “jazz”]

for i in musics;

print(i)

Kết quả của chương trình là:

ballad

rock

jazz

ballad, rock, jazz

7.

MULTIPLE CHOICE QUESTION

10 mins • 1 pt

Cho đoạn chương trình Python sau:

sum = 0

i = 1

while i < 100:

sum = sum + i

i = i +1

print(sum)

Đề bài của bài toán này là:

Tính tổng các số từ 1 đến 99

Tính tổng các số từ 1 đến 100

Liệt kê các số từ 1 đến 100

Liệt kê các số từ 1 đến 99

Access all questions and much more by creating a free account

Create resources

Host any resource

Get auto-graded reports

Google

Continue with Google

Email

Continue with Email

Classlink

Continue with Classlink

Clever

Continue with Clever

or continue with

Microsoft

Microsoft

Apple

Apple

Others

Others

Already have an account?